Reconfigurable, Corrugated Graphene Plasmonics

Abstract

The objective of this proposal is to investigate the nature of plasmons in corrugated graphene, with the goal of determining whether graphene corrugation could provide a pathway to creating tunable, higher energy graphene plasmons.
